‘Resident Evil’ and the Tightrope of Relaunching Old IP

Sep 10, 2026 · 36m

Summary

Oliver Bourbon, CEO of Constantin Film, discusses the studio’s strategy for managing the Resident Evil franchise, including how director Zach Creger’s unique pitch led to the new film’s production with Sony. The conversation covers the challenges of international film distribution, the impact of streaming services on European markets, and Constantin’s historical rights deals with Marvel. The episode concludes with a box office prediction for the upcoming release of Practical Magic.
